1. Botanic Garden

Located in the heart of the city, the Botanic Garden spans over 54 hectares. It attracts a diverse range of tourists with its pristine natural forest and vibrant flower gardens. Particularly, the Botanic Garden houses the Swan Lake – a Victorian-style architectural masterpiece, and it is home to over 12,000 rare orchid species. If you are a flower enthusiast representing purity, skipping the Botanic Garden would be a significant loss.

2. Butterfly Park and Insect Kingdom

Situated on Sentosa Island, this park will amaze visitors with its abundance of giant butterflies and insects. With over 50 butterfly species comprising 2,500 individuals and more than 3,000 insect species, including rare ones like stick insects, giant spiders, and human-faced mantises, the park is a haven for nature lovers. Additionally, the park features over 5,000 twinkling fireflies illuminating the night sky.

Ticket Prices:
+ Adults: S$16
+ Children: S$10

4. River Safari – World's Largest Freshwater Aquarium

Encompassing nearly 12 hectares and showcasing over 300 species of animals from 8 major river systems worldwide such as the Mekong, Amazon, and Mississippi rivers, River Safari is considered the first wild river park in Asia. Beyond the world of animals, this place is a botanical paradise with over 150 different plant species. River Safari opens its doors to visitors every day, from 9 am to 6 pm.
Ticket Prices:
+ Adults: S$35
+ Children aged 3 – 12: S$23
+ Seniors: S$17
5. Clarke Quay Night Street

Clarke Quay Night Street is the hub of European-style sidewalk cafes. For those who love vibrancy, visit the Ministry of Sound (MOS) club – home to 14 bars equipped with state-of-the-art sound and lighting systems. And for food enthusiasts, the culinary entertainment district at Clarke Quay truly is a paradise.
